This role requires a proactive and independent individual who is able to work collaboratively and see tasks through to completion. You will play a key role in supporting the division’s management reporting, planning, budgeting and data management functions. Responsibilities • Support and coordinate the collation, sensemaking and preparation of monthly management reports and quarterly trackers for senior management’s review, including highlighting key trends, risks and issues to support decision-making • Oversee the budget performance at Group, Division and programme levels. This includes forecasting, monitoring utilisation of funds, preparing and maintaining expenditure reports, flagging variances and working with relevant stakeholders to ensure timely utilisation • Oversee the tracking and management of data incidents and data requests received, ensuring that records are maintained accurately and any follow-up actions are coordinated and closed out in a timely manner • Monitor and coordinate multiple cross-divisional projects and timelines, ensuring alignment with organisational goals and workplan outcomes • Work closely with divisions to coordinate inputs, ensure consistency in submissions and support planning and governance processes across Group • Drive continuous improvements to internal reporting and budgeting processes to enhance efficiency and support better decision-making Requirements • Degree in any discipline, with at least 3-5 years of relevant experience in management reporting, planning, budgeting or related functions • Proficient in Microsoft Office applications, particularly Excel and Powerpoint •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to synthesise information from multiple sources and translate it into meaningful insights • Proven ability to coordinate across stakeholders and man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ment • Good understanding of budgeting or governance processes would be an advantage • Self-driven, meticulous, adaptable and able to work both independently and collaboratively in a dynamic environment
